Should I do this barter?


I have a cosmetic service that costs about $3500. I have a client who is a realtor. We talked about the possibility of a barter my service in exchange for $3500 out of his commision on the sale of my house. Since discussing it, I have found that I won't need his real estate services for a year or longer, however he needs my services now.

Should I:

A) go ahead with the barter, allowing him to use my services now, and cash in on his services next year.

B) Collect half on my services now so I don't run the risk of something going wrong (he could die, go out of business, etc.) and then barter on the remaining balance if and when I need his services.

C) Cancel the proposal to barter and simply pay each other for services rendered.

D) Other suggestion..

Dont Barter! House prices are constantly falling up and down. And your house may not be worth that much in a year, or you may change your mind about selling it.
Tell him to make some real cash dont try and risk it

it's risky going forward with your half now - he could quit being a realtor in the next year, then you're SOL - the individual realtor only gets 1/4 of the total commission on a sale anyway - is the whole transaction commission going to be worth 14000 or more ? (house selling for at least 235,000 at 6% commission? - if not, you're likely to get screwed out of your part of the deal

I think C would be your safest bet. Unless you sign some form of legal document between the two of you, there is no way to know for sure if you will ever get your side of the barter. By then he will have already got what he wanted and have no compelling reason other than his honor to do his half of the bargain.

I say go with what everyone is saying, just tell him that you don't need his services for the next year and as a business owner you can not give services out and wait a year to be paid it is just not good business!
